How do you become a nurse practitioner?

  • after this semester i will have a bachelors in biology and want to be a nurse practitioner. i know i have to be an rn first. how long total will it take to be a nurse practitioner and what are all the tests you have to take in the process? thank you for any help!

  • Answer:

    You are a nurse with extra qualifications in that position. My sister is a retired school nurse-practitioner, by the way. She had a 4-year nursing degree and a master's in education (taught at a local nursing school for a while) that may not be necessary and completed a 30 credit hour program leading to certification as a nurse-practitioner. Become an RN first, then back to school is the answer. Her back to school place was Crouse-Irving Hospital in Syracuse, NY.
